  • This video is based on an 1870 sausage stuffer:
    • Let's make Bratwurst! ...
    The meat contained in the blue cylinder is pressed forward into the casings (not shown) by the pink piston. The operator turns the orange crank to move the piston through the gear train and rack-and-pinion mechanism.
    The interesting thing about this type of stuffing machine is that the pressure is created by the circular rack with annular teeth instead of the regular rack. It provides simplicity in manufacturing and assembly.
    The video also demonstrates how to remove the cylinder from the stuffer.
